Аналого-цифровой преобразователь

 

Изобретение относится к вычислительной технике и позволяет повысить помехоустсйчивость и расширить функциональные возможности путем обеспечения контроля процесса преобразования . Это достигается тем, что в аналого-цифровой преобразователь, содержаний блок 1 эталонных напряжений , первый блок 2 коммутации, первый 3 и второй 4 блоки суммирования, блок 5 сравнения, два регистра 6 и 7 и блок 8 управления, введены регистры 9 и 10, второй блок 11 коммутации, сдвигающий регистр 12, элемент 13 эквивалентности, элемент И 14 и элемент ИЛИ 15. 1 з.п. ф-лы, 2 ил., 1 табл.

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ИК

А1 (19) (11) (51) 4 Н 03 И 1/38

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

Н А ВТОРСН0МУ С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(21) 3604374/24-24 (22) 13.06.83

1(46) 07.09.86. Бюл. Р 33 (71) Харьковский ордена Трудового

Красного Знамени институт радиоэлектроники (72) Н.В. Алипов и А.И. Тимченко (53) 681.325(088.8) (56) Авторское свидетельство СССР

В 954572, кл. F 01 С 19/00, 1980.

Проблемы создания преобразовате лей формы информации. Ч.2, — К.: Наукова думка, 1980, с. 12-20. (54) АНАЛОГО-ЦИФРОВОЙ ПРЕОБРАЗОВАТЕЛЬ (57) Изобретение относится к вычислительной технике и позволяет повысить помехоустсйчивость и расширить функциональные возможности путем обеспечения контроля процесса преобразования.. Это достигается тем, что в аналого-цифровой преобразователь, содержащий блок 1 эталонных напряжений, первый блок 2 коммутации, первый

3 и второй 4 блоки суммирования, блок

5 сравнения, два регистра 6 и 7 и блок 8 управления, введены регистры

9 и 10, второй блок 11 коммутации, сдвигающий регистр 12, элемент 13 эквивалентности, элемент И 14 и элемент ИЛИ 15. 1 з.п. ф-лы, 2 ил.

1 табл. 1256206

Изобретение относится к вычислительной технике и может быть использовано в различных информационно-иэ" мернтельньтх системах, к которым предъявляются повьнпенные требования к достоверности получаемых реэультатоз.

Цель изобретения — повьппение помехоустойчивости и расширение функциональных возможностей путем обеспече- 1О ния контроля процесса преобразования.

На фиг. 1 приведена функциональная схема устройства; на фиг. 2 — функцион1льная схема блока управления.

Ачалого-цифровой преобразователь 15 содержит блок 1 эталонных напряжений,,блок 2 коммутации, блоки 3 и 4 суммирования, блок 5 сравнения, регистры

6 и 7, состоящие из триггеров, блок

8 управления, регистры 9 и 10, втерой 20 блок 11 коммутации, сдвигающий регистр 12, элемент 13 эквивалентности, элемент И 14, выход которого является шиной контроля, элемент ИЛИ 15. Блок

8 управления содержит шину 16 "За- 25 пуск", генератор. 17 импульсов, эле мент И 18 и сдвигающий регистр 19.

Сущность алгоритма уравновешивания преобразуемой величины, положенного в основу предлагаемого устройст- Ç0 ва, заключающийся в уравновешивании напряжений (токов) U< и U

Состояние

i-х разрядов регистров остояние выхоов i-ro ключа ервого блока 2 второго 11) оммутации

Первый Второй 1 (третий (четвер ,0 б (9) тый)

7 (10) 0

1

0

U9,/2

0 .

V„/2

Ug +h=-U,;

=14 +U (1) где П, =) (1) — + {1) ? э, (2)! +

+ о (2) + +э (п) +g (n)- ф

Ф. 2

"э .

= K. (, ().) + м (1) )- ; I t =) ,, (1) "эт +„(1) "и +,.(2) "н +

+ca (2) — эт +... +М (п) — э) + М (п) — йх — . (a, (1,)+О (1.) —,), i%i

n — разрядность регистров 6, 7, 9 и 10

1 с п{i) et (i) C (i) и оа (i) — двоичные коэффициенты, определяе.мые состояниями i-х разрядов регистров 6 и 7 и 9 и 10 соответственно;

У вЂ” величина уравновешивающего эталона, который может быть положительным нли отрицательным, причем U = h 2" (h— дискретность преобразования), После окончания цикла уравновеши1 вания сумма значений величин U,и П постоянна и определяется соотношением, + U h(2 -2) ° (2)

Иа прямом выходе блока 5 сравнения на любом i-м такте уравновешивания вырабатывается код результата сравнения X (i) 1 (на инверсном выходе

x(i) О), если U< U, и код э6 (1) 0 (М (1) 1) - в противном случае.

Источник 1 вырабатывает на своих выходах следующие эталонные напряжеЬ

HHB (токи : U /2 9 Ugy /4 > ° е е yvyy /2 9 ...,Uö. /2. Каждая эталонная величина

U» у- (х 1,2 3 n) подключается к входам i-х ключей первого 2 и второго

11 блоков коммутации.

Первый блок 2 (второй 11) коммутации представляет собой набор из п трехпозиционных аналоговых ключей.

Работой каждого клю а управляют прямые выходы соответствующих разрядов регистров 6, 7, 9 и 10.

В таблице показаны состояния выходов любого i-го ключа блоков 2 и 11 коммутации в зависимости от состояния

1-х разрядов управляющих регистров.

Причем l.-е разряды первого (третье! го) 6(9) и второго (четвертого) 7(10} регистров одновременно не могут находиться в единичном состоянии, тах как последйие определяются парафаэнымн выходами блока 5 сравнения. Поэтому состояния выходов i-ro ключа блоков 2 и 11 коммутации для такой комбинации входов не определены (таблица) .

Блок 8 управления последовательно на каждом из своих выходов вырабаты-, 1256 вает тактовые импульсы. Импульс по шине 16 "Запуск" (он же является установочным выходом блока 8 управления) устанавливает на всех (2п+1) прямых выходах сдвигающего регистра

19 нулевые потенциалы. При этом нулевой потенциал с (2+1)-го выхода сдвигающего регистра 19 разрешает прохождение импульсов с генератора

17 через элемент И 18 на вход реги- 10 стра 19, При этом на выходах последнего с приходом каждого импульса от генератора 17 последовательно формируются тактовые импульсы.

Устройство работает следующим об- 15 ,разом.

Импульс с установочного выхода блока 8 управления (i=O) устанавливает все разряды регистров 6, 7, 9 и

10 в нулевое состояние, При этом на всех выходах блоков 2 и 11 устанавливаются нулевые потенциалы. На выходах блоков 3 и 4 суммирования устанавлиBBloTcH cHI HcUIbl U2 — Ul! и U! — О, Ко торые сравниваются блоком 5. На прямом и инверсном выходах последнего вырабатываются соответственно коды

@(0) и !е(0) = О результата сравнения.

Если U ) О, то эх (О) = 1 (М (0)=0), если О„ыО М(0) = О (эеТО) = 1).

При поступлении первого тактового импульса с первого выхода блока 8 старшие разряды регистров 6 и 7 принимают состояния соответственноIl!,(1)=35

= Э6(0) иа,(1) = Эх,(0). В зависимости от состояний старших разрядов регистров б и 7 (таблица) эталонная величина U /2 подключается к первому 3 или второму 4 блокам. На этом такте бло- 40 ком 5 вырабатываются коды результата сравнения чс (1) и Эг Г ), значения которых определяются соотношением значений напряжений (токов) U< и U . .На втором такте с приходом тактового им-45 пульса с второго выхода блока 8 старшие разряды регистров 9 и 10 принимают состояния соответственно !!с (1)=

=М(1) и са (1) = М(1) . При этом эталонное напряжение Б /2, которое пос- 50 тупает на вход первого ключа блока

11 коммутации, в зависимости от состояний разрядов !!,!(1) и!! (1) регист3 ров 9 .и 10 подключается к первому 3 или второму 4 блокам. На этом же так-55 те формируются блоком 5 коды Ж (2) и зе(2). На третьем и четвертом тактах в уравновешивании участвует эта206 4 лонная величина U„/4, на пятом и шестом тактах — U„/8 и т.д.

По окончании цикла уравновешивания на входах блока 5 присутствуют напряжения U и U<, отличающиеся друг от друга на величину, не превышающую

h (если Uqr = Ь 2")

+n=U;

Up +h Z (a i) + a ) (i ) ) 2" +h

ll

h 0 (g,(i) +!х (1)) 2 (3) ! =! или У„+h(No + N ) +Ь= и(!1 + N ) где N,,N»N< и N — коды, отраженные соответственно в регистрах 6,7, 9 и 10.

Код в регистре 7(10) представляет собой обратный -код в регистре 6(9).

Двоичный эквивалент П„ согласно.(1) может быть определен

U„= U, — и, = nf(N+N) (N, N )j,(4)

С учетом соотношения (2.) значение

U может быть найдено также из выражений

2h((N,+N ) — (2"-1)1 i (5)

Пх 2h Г(2 1) (Й +N ) ° (6)

Соотношения (4) — (6) показывают, что для определения двоичного эквиВалента U„ можно использовать либо все коды !1, N, N и И!1, либо только коды Я, и Я, либо только коды М и N

К а любом 1-м такте уравновешивания действие сбоя может привести к неправильному результату сравнения значений величины U u U и согласно алгоритму работы устройства к неправильному включению последующего веса . разряда. Величина Z, равная сумме ! нескомпенсированной части преобразуемого напряжения (тока) (ь0„(i-1)) на предыдущих тактах и веса неправильно включенного разряда, определяется выражением

Zi =) d Ua (i-1) ) n ° 2", i=1,2,...,2n, где $i/2, если 1. кратно 2;

3 = I )i/2(+1 — в противном случае.

Эта величина может быть скомпенсирована только весами разрядов, еще не участвовавших в уравновешивании.

Сумма весов последних S. определяется выражением

12562

S. =g(i-2j) .? " 2 +8(n-j) -2h(2 -i), I

1,2„...,2п, где 0 (° ) = 1, если () 8 О, и 0 (° ) в противном случае. Погрешность преобразования i при возникновении сбоя на i-м такте определяется с разностью величин Zi u S i= П (1-1) +h 2 (f-g(i-2j))-8(n-j)1o х 211(2 -1), i = 1,2, ., 2n (?) где йU (0)

Если учесть, что величина (V4 (i-1),1(1 ) 1) не может быть больше 15 и-) веса разряда h 2, на котором происходит сбой, то из соотношения (7) видно, что величина погрешности преобразования,/ai/ а 2h при возникновении единичного сбоя на любом из тактов 20 уравновашивания.

При отсутствии сбоев и динамических погрешностей в процессе работы устройства любые три последовательных результата сравнения не могуг быть 25 эквивалентными (равными), т. е. для любых последовательных сравнений комбинации кодов результатов сравнений. 111 и 000 являются запрещенными.

По появлению таких комбинаций можно судить о возникновении сбоя, динамической погрешности или превышении значения преобразуемой величины U< верхней или нижней границ диапазона преобразуемых величин, В предлагаемом устройстве этот контроль осуществляется с помощью трехразрядного сдвигающего регистра 12 (в который записываются последовательные результаты сравнения), элемента 13, элемента

И 14 и элемента ИЛИ 15. По появлению импульса на выходе элемента И 14 на тактах, начиная с третьего (при этом на выходе элемента ИЛИ 15 единичныи импульс)р мОжнО судить О Воз 45 никновении сбоя или динамической погрешности в процессе преобразования.

Таким образом, аналого-цифровой преобразователь обладает повышенной помехоустойчивостью к воздействию им-5О пульсных помех и сбоям в элементах

его структуры, повышенной способностью к коррекции динамических погрешностей, вызванных изменением сигнала за время преобразования.

Формула и з обретения

1. Аналого-цифровой преобразователь, содержащий первый блок комму06 б тации, блок эталонных напряжении, первый и второй блоки суммирования, блок сравнения, первый и второй регистры и блок управления, установочный выход которого соединен с входами сброса в "0" первого и второго регистров, первые входы установки в всех разрядов первого регистра объединены и соединены с первым выходом блока сравнения, первые входы установки в "1" всех разрядов второго регистра объединены и соединены с вторым входом блока сравнения, вторые входы установки в "1" разрядов первого и второго регистров поразрядно объединены и соединены с соответствующими нечетными выходами блока управления, первый вход первого блока суммирования является шиной преобразуемого напряжения, вторые входы первого блока суммирования соединены с первыми выходами первого блока коммутации, выход первого блока суммиро:вания соединен с первым входом блока сравнения, выходы источника эталонных напряжений соединены с соответствующими первыми входами первого блока коммутации, вторые входы которого в каждом разряде соединены с выходами соответствующего разряда первого регистра, третьи входы блока коммутации — с выходами соответствующего разряда второго регистра, вторые выходы первого блока коммутации соединены с общей шиной, третьи выходы— с первыми входами второго блока суммирования, выход которого соединен с вторым входом блока сравнения, о т— л и ч а ю шийся тем, что, с целью повышения помехоустойчивости и расширения функциональных возможностей путем обеспечения контроля процесса преобразования, в него введены второй блок коммутации, третий и четвертый регистры, сдвигающий регистр, элемент эквивалентности, элемент И, элемент ИЛИ, при этом первые входы второго блока коммутации соединены с выходами блока эталонных напряжений, вторые входы — .с выходами соответствующих разрядов третьего регистра, третьи входы — с выходами соответствующих разрядов четвертого регистра, вход сброса в "0" которого объединен с входом сброса в "0" третьего регистра и соединены с установочным входом блока управления,первые входы установки в "1" всех разрядов третьего регистра объединены и

1256206

f!70k

Составитель А. Титов ю

Техред A.Êðàâ÷óê КорректорС.Черни

Редактор И. Шулла

Заказ 4836/57

Тираж 816 Подписное,ВН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Рауш=кая наб., д. 4!5

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4 соединены соответственно с первым выходом блока сравнения, первые входы установки в "1" всех разрядов четвертого регистра объединены и соединены с вторым выходом блока сравнения, а вторые входы установки в "1" третьего и четвертого регистров поразрядно объединены и соединены с соответствующими четными выходами блока управления, причем третьи входы первого блока суммирования соединены с первыми выходами втордго блока коммутации, вторые выходы которого соединены с вторыми входами второго блока суммирования, а третьи выходы - с общей шиной, первый выход блока сравнения соединен с входом сдвигающего регистра, выходы которого соединены соответственно с входами элемента эквивалентности, выход которого соединен,с первым входом элемента И,второй вход которого соединен с выходом элемента ИЛИ, входы которого соединены с соответствующими выходами блока управления, выход элемента И является шиной контроля.

2. Преобразователь по п; 1, о тл и ч а ю шийся тем, что,блок управления выполнен на генераторе импульсов, элементе И, сдвигающем репи1О, стре, при этом прямой выход старшего разряда сдвигающего регистра соединен с первым входом элемента И, второй вход которого соединен с выходом генератора импульсов, выход эле- мента И подключен к входу синхронизации сдвигающего регистра, причем шина "Запуск" является входом установки в "0" сдвигающего регистра и установочным выходом блока управления, а

20 выходы разрядов сдвиганлцего регистра ,являются соответствечно нечетными и . четными выходами блока управления.

Аналого-цифровой преобразователь Аналого-цифровой преобразователь Аналого-цифровой преобразователь Аналого-цифровой преобразователь Аналого-цифровой преобразователь 

 

Похожие патенты:

Изобретение относится к автоматике и вычислительной технике, в частности к устройствам, преобразуюпщм линейное или угловое перемещение в код, и может быть И(пользовано для контроля величины перемещения механизмов на станках и установках , предназначенных для контроля и обработки изделий

Изобретение относится к автоматике и вычислительной, технике и предназначено для преобразования угловых перемещений в последовательность электрических импульсов

Изобретение относится к автоматике и вычислительной технике и может применяться для автоматизированного контроля преобразователей угла поворота вала в код в статических и динамических режимах с любым выбранным объемом проверок

Изобретение относится к контрольно-измерительной технике, может использоваться для экспериментальных исследований и контроля погрешности аналого-цифровьк преобразователей (АЦП) и цифровых вольтметров и является усовершенствованием известного устройства по авт.св

Изобретение относится к измерительной и вычислительной технике.

Изобретение относится к вычислительной технике и может быть использовано в области аналого-цифровых преобразователей

Изобретение относится к автоматике и Е1лчислительной технике и может быть использовано для нелинейного преобразования широтно-импуль-- сных сигналов в код

Изобретение относится к автоматике и вычислительной технике и может быть использовано для преобразования угла поворота вала в код

Изобретение относится к области авто матики и предназначено для 11реобразоБания перемещений в цифровой код

Изобретение относится к области электроизмерительной и вычислительной техники и может быть использовано для поверки аналого-цифровых преобразователей

Изобретение относится к аналого-цифровым преобразователям (АЦП) и измерительной технике и может применятся при измерениях в машиностроении

Изобретение относится к устройствам сопряжения аналоговых и цифровых сигналов, а именно к аналого-цифровым преобразователям уравновешивающего типа, и может быть использовано для обработки электрокардиограмм, электроэнцефалограмм, а также других аналоговых сигналов в медицине и других отраслях науки и техники

Изобретение относится к контрольно-измерительной технике и предназначено для автоматизации измерения и контроля различных неэлектрических величин, которые могут быть преобразованы из энергии внешнего источника одного вида в энергию электрическую, используемую в системах сбора и обработки данных и в системах управления, работающих в реальном масштабе времени измерения

Изобретение относится к контрольно-измерительной технике и предназначено для автоматизации измерения и контроля различных неэлектрических величин, которые могут быть преобразованы из энергии внешнего источника одного вида в энергию электрическую, используемую в системах сбора и обработки данных и в системах управления, работающих в реальном масштабе времени измерения

Изобретение относится к электротехнике и может быть использовано для автоматизации управления реверсивными электроприводами протяженных конвейеров возвратно-поступательного движения

Изобретение относится к способу обработки цифровых сигналов, а точнее к процессам и схемам преобразования аналоговых сигналов в цифровые представления этих аналоговых сигналов

Изобретение относится к измерительной технике и может быть использовано в системе преобразования сигнала из аналоговой формы в цифровую

Изобретение относится к автоматике и вычислительной технике и может быть использовано для связи аналоговых источников информации с цифровым вычислительным устройством

Изобретение относится к автоматике и вычислительной технике и может быть использовано для связи аналоговых источников информации с цифровым вычислительным устройством
Наверх